Sublimation-like Behavior of Cardiac Dynamics in Heart Failure: A Malignant Phase Transition?

Ary L Goldberger1, Teresa Henriques1, Sara Mariani2.   

Abstract

An abrupt transition from sinus cardiac rhythm to atrial fibrillation (AF) is common in patients with chronic heart failure (CHF). We propose a conceptual framework for viewing this malignant transition in terms of a type of sublimation marked by the switch from highly periodic sinus interbeat interval dynamics characteristic of CHF to a state of random disorganization with AF. Sublimation of physical substances involves an increase in entropy via heat transfer. In contrast, the disease-related sublimation-like behavior involves a loss of information content, associated decreases in cardiac bioenergetic capacity and in multiscale entropy.
